Línea de tiempo (lit. 'Timeline') is a 2023 Colombian action thriller film written, directed and edited by Yesid Leone.[1] It stars María Fernanda Yepes[2] accompanied by Osvaldo León, Roberto Escobar, Adrián Díaz, Alexander Guzmán and Carlos Congote.[3] It premiered on April 27, 2023, in Colombian theaters.[4]
Joaquín Lara, a successful business man, is going through the best moment of his life. However, while having dinner at a prestigious restaurant in the city, he meets his ex-girlfriend Nina Nadal, who will soon leave the country to rebuild her life abroad. The meeting passes calmly until Joaquín receives a series of mysterious text messages, in which he is required to publish some evidence in that place and thus reveal some dark secrets of certain people present there as well. Otherwise, he is warned that the woman accompanying him “Nina” will be murdered once he leaves the restaurant if he does not comply with the objective. Thus begins a gruesome game in a closed public place where everyone's life is at risk.[5]

Production
Principal photography took place in 2021 in Medellín, Colombia.[7][8]
